Sausage & Peppers with Tuscan Spice

Sausage and peppers with Tuscan spice

Ingredients

  • 1½ pounds Italian sausage links
  • 3 bell peppers, sliced
  • 1 large onion, sliced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 teaspoons Paul’s Nickel Bag Tuscan Spice
  • 2 garlic cloves, sliced
  • ½ cup crushed tomatoes
  • Fresh basil
  • Crusty rolls or creamy polenta, for serving

Method

  1.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Brown the sausages in one tablespoon olive oil, then transfer to a plate.
  2. Add the remaining oil, peppers and onion. Cook until softened and lightly charred.
  3. Stir in the garlic and Tuscan Spice. Add the tomatoes and return the sausages to the pan.
  4. Cover and simmer for 15 minutes, until the sausages are cooked through. Finish with basil and serve in rolls or over polenta.

Pour it with Barbera d’Asti DOCG.

Barbera’s bright acidity cuts through the sausage while its cherry fruit keeps pace with sweet peppers and tomato.
